Date Bark

This viral Date Bark recipe combines chewy Medjool dates with peanut butter, crunchy almonds, dark chocolate, and flaky sea salt. So good!

Prep Time
10 mins
Total Time
10 mins
Servings: 24 pieces
Calories: 144 kcal
Course: Dessert , Snacks
Cuisine: American

Ingredients

  • 24 Medjool dates pitted
  • ½ cup peanut butter warmed
  • ½ cup almonds chopped
  • 4 ounces dark chocolate melted
  • Flaky sea salt

Instructions

    Cup of Yum
  1. Line a quarter sheet pan with parchment paper.
  2. Place the medjool dates, open side up on a parchment paper in rows of 4 and columns of 6. Use your hands or a cup (with cooking spray) to press them down onto the baking sheet as close together as possible.
  3. Drizzle with peanut butter and sprinkle almonds on top. Drizzle the melted chocolate on top and use a spatula to spread out evenly. Sprinkle with salt and freeze for 30 minutes.
  4. When the chocolate is set, break into about 24 pieces. Keep in the fridge for best results
